MX7524JCSE by Analog Devices: 8 Bit Digital to Analog Converter 1 16-SOIC.

This is the official active lead-free (RoHS) direct replacement from the original manufacturer. It has identical specifications, pinout, and dimensions to the obsolete MX7524JCSE, enabling a seamless drop-in transition without any redesign.

  • Official direct lead-free (RoHS compliant) replacement from the original manufacturer.
  • Identical electrical specifications, including a 500ns settling time and ±0.5 LSB maximum INL.
  • Matches original commercial temperature range of 0°C to 70°C.

The AD7524JRZ serves as a highly reliable second-source alternative from Analog Devices. It is pin-compatible and matches key performance characteristics, with the added benefit of a wider industrial operating temperature range.

  • Pin-compatible second-source alternative from Analog Devices.
  • Wider industrial operating temperature range (-40°C to 85°C vs 0°C to 70°C for the original).
  • Identical unbuffered current-output R-2R architecture and 500ns settling time.
